Review: Does Benefit “They’re Real!” Mascara Really Work?

Benefit markets They’re Real! mascara as a super mascara that would almost cause one to wonder if you’re wearing false lashes. Put to the lie detector test, when asked if your lashes are real, you’d pass! Now, I love mascara as much as the next lady, and to be honest, nothing has worked better for me than L’Oreal’s Voluminous. I’ve just tried a lot of mascaras and none of them were worth the extra $10-$15 investment. Hence, when Benefit sent me their new mascara, I decided to put it to the test. Do a comparison between my stand by and They’re Real!

They’re Real! put to the test:

When first putting on, there wasn’t much to be noticed with the difference. I always put on one coat, let it set and put on a second coat. At first I didn’t see much of a difference until we took the photos. It was clear that They’re Real! had plumped my lashes much more than Voluminous. Now, they both had about the same length, but the plumping was certainly unsurpassed.

Wearing through out the day, I noticed They’re Real! did not flake, and when it came to taking off my makeup, it requires an eye makeup remover, which I’m not used to using in addition to my regular facial cleanser. Is it worth it? I’d say yes, my lashes are really lush. As lush as wearing false lashes? No… but good enough.
